    A partial wave analysis of antiproton-proton annihilation data in flight at 900 Formula omitted into Formula omitted, Formula omitted and Formula omitted is presented. The data were taken at LEAR by the Crystal Barrel experiment in 1996. The three channels have been coupled together with Formula omitted-scattering isospin I = 0 S- and D-wave as well as I = 1 P-wave data utilizing the K-matrix approach. Analyticity is treated using Chew-Mandelstam functions. In the fit all ingredients of the K-matrix, including resonance masses and widths, were treated as free parameters. In spite of the large number of parameters, the fit results are in the ballpark of the values published by the Particle Data Group. In the channel Formula omitted a significant contribution of the spin exotic Formula omitted Formula omitted Formula omitted-wave with a coupling to Formula omitted is observed. Furthermore the contributions of Formula omitted and Formula omitted in the channel Formula omitted have been studied in detail. The differential production cross section for the two reactions and the spin-density-matrix elements for the Formula omitted and Formula omitted have been extracted. No spin-alignment is observed for both vector mesons. The spin density matrix elements have been also determined for the spin exotic wave.
